For 'Love at First Sight,' audience emotional responses are primarily driven by the central romance. 'Love,' 'Joy,' 'Happiness,' and 'Hope' are prominent as viewers follow Hadley and Oliver's serendipitous meeting and the desire for their reunion. The 'Drama' genre elements introduce 'Sadness' and 'Melancholy' during their separation and the uncertainty of fate, alongside 'Anxiety' and 'Anticipation' for whether they will find each other again. 'Empathy' is strong as audiences connect with the characters' journey, leading to 'Relief' and 'Satisfaction' if they ultimately reunite, and 'Inspiration' from the power of connection.
